  • Patent number: 9296097
    Abstract: A rectangular one-piece unitary block of hard durable material has a central slot opening through one side and the bottom. The depth of the slot measured from the bottom of the block to the slot base in the interior is greater toward such one side. The slot becomes progressively more shallow in a direction toward the opposite side of the block to a location where the slot feathers into the bottom. The head of a high fastener projecting from an exposed edge of a T & G plank can be captured in the deeper portion of the slot, followed by shifting the block with its bottom engaged against the plank and the fastener head engaged by the base of the slot while rapping the top of the block with a hammer. The high fastener is thereby progressively driven to a set position.

  • Patent number: 8464612
    Abstract: The manual nailing process can injure the person's hand gripping the nail when the nail head is missed. The underlying surface of the work (the object being nailed, made of wood or other relevant materials) can be damaged when the hammer hits the work surface instead of the nail or from the hammer claws when the nail is extracted. The nailing aid described in this application holds the nail when it is being started, away from the person's hand. This aid also provides protection for a broad area of the underlying work surface around the nail, when the nail is being struck or extracted. The striking surface of the aid is sloped to prevent it from being trapped by a bent nail or a nail head. The handle of this aid also serves as a holder for an optional nail set or pencil.

  • Patent number: 8230765
    Abstract: A device which aids in the insertion and removal of tree steps within a tree, particularly during hunting, is herein disclosed, comprising an offset “L”-shaped crank with an upper end that has a hole which slips over the step portion of the tree step. An offset lower end of the crank comprises an outward facing rotating handle. To use the device, the user inserts a tree step into the tree using its pointed end, the device is slid over the step, and the step is cranked into the tree using the increased leverage provided by the device. Should the step need to be removed, the process is reversed by turning the device in a counter clockwise manner.
